数据仓库和大数据的区别,解析数据存储的不同

网友投稿 693 2024-03-22


了解数据仓库和大数据


在当今数字时代,数据变得举足轻重。数据的快速增长导致了许多新的技术和概念的出现。数据仓库和大数据是两个重要的概念,它们在数据存储和分析方面起着关键作用。但是,数据仓库和大数据之间有什么区别呢?本文将深入探讨数据仓库和大数据的区别,帮助您更好地理解它们。


数据仓库:整合与查询的核心


数据仓库和大数据的区别,解析数据存储的不同

数据仓库是一个基于主题的、集成的、可变动的、非易失性的数据集合,用于支持管理决策。它主要用于企业内部,用于整合、存储和查询各种结构化和半结构化数据。


数据仓库的主要特点包括:


1. 面向主题


数据仓库以主题为导向,将数据组织成易于理解和分析的方式。它关注业务相关的数据,例如销售、客户、产品等。


2. 集成性


数据仓库通过整合来自不同数据源的数据,包括企业内部的各种数据库、文件和外部数据源。这种集成性使得数据仓库能够提供全面、准确的数据。


3. 非易失性


数据仓库中的数据是非易失的,即一旦存储在数据仓库中,就不会被随意修改或删除。这样可以确保历史数据的完整性。


4. 支持复杂查询


数据仓库设计用于支持复杂的查询和分析操作。它提供了强大的查询功能,使用户能够通过多维分析、数据挖掘等方式深入挖掘数据背后的模式和关联。


大数据:挑战和机遇


大数据是指数据量大、处理速度快、种类繁多的数据集合。大数据主要由日志文件、社交媒体内容、传感器数据、图像视频等非结构化和半结构化数据组成。


大数据的主要特点包括:


1. 数量庞大


大数据是指以TB、PB甚至EB为单位的数据量。随着互联网的普及和信息化程度的提高,大量的数据被不断地生成和积累。


2. 多样性


大数据不仅包括结构化数据,还包括半结构化和非结构化数据。这些数据来自各种不同的来源,如社交媒体、传感器、日志文件等。


3. 处理速度快


传统的数据处理工具往往无法满足大数据的高速处理需求。因此,大数据的处理通常需要使用并行处理、分布式计算等技术。


4. 数据价值


大数据蕴含着巨大的商业价值。通过对大数据的分析,企业可以挖掘出隐藏在数据中的商机和趋势,做出更明智的决策。


数据仓库 vs. 大数据:两者的区别


现在,我们来看看数据仓库和大数据之间的区别:


1. 数据类型


数据仓库主要用于存储和分析结构化和半结构化数据,如关系型数据库中的表格数据。而大数据则主要包括非结构化和半结构化数据,如文本、图片、音频等。


2. 数据处理方式


数据仓库采用传统的批处理方式,对数据进行清洗、转换和加载,以供分析和查询使用。而大数据则需要采用实时处理和流式处理技术,以应对海量数据的高速增长和实时要求。


3. 数据规模


数据仓库通常处理较小规模的数据,可以在单个服务器上进行操作。而大数据则涉及到大规模的数据集合,需要使用集群和分布式计算来处理。


4. 数据粒度


数据仓库通常以较为精细的粒度来存储数据,以支持复杂的查询和多维分析。而大数据则更注重原始数据的保留,以便后续的深度分析和挖掘。


结论


数据仓库和大数据在数据存储和分析方面有着不同的角色和功能。数据仓库主要用于整合和查询结构化和半结构化数据,支持管理决策。而大数据则专注于处理海量的非结构化和半结构化数据,挖掘其中的商业价值。理解数据仓库和大数据的区别,有助于企业更好地在数字时代利用数据进行决策和创新。


常见问题解答


1. 数据仓库和大数据可以同时使用吗?


是的,数据仓库和大数据可以同时使用。数据仓库用于整合结构化和半结构化数据,而大数据可以用于处理非结构化和半结构化数据。


2. 数据仓库和大数据在企业中的应用场景有哪些?


数据仓库在企业中的应用场景包括销售分析、客户关系管理、供应链管理等。而大数据的应用场景包括智能推荐系统、舆情监测、机器学习等。


3. 数据仓库和大数据的建设成本如何?


数据仓库的建设成本相对较高,需要购买硬件设备和数据库软件,并进行数据清洗和转换。而大数据的建设成本也较高,需要购买大数据平台和分布式存储系统,以及培训专业人员。


4. 数据仓库和大数据的安全性如何保障?


数据仓库和大数据都涉及敏感的商业数据,安全性非常重要。企业可以采用数据加密、访问控制、身份认证等技术来保障数据的安全。


5. 数据仓库和大数据对企业的重要性如何?


数据仓库和大数据对企业的重要性不可忽视。数据仓库能够提供企业决策所需的全面、准确的数据;而大数据则可以挖掘数据背后的商机和趋势,为企业提供商业洞察和竞争优势。

上一篇:如何预测保险公司BI数据的成本是多少钱
下一篇:保险公司全球BI软件排名多少钱
相关文章